原文:《算法 - 摩尔投票算法》

一:摩尔算法核心 最基本的摩尔投票问题,找出一组数字序列中出现次数大于总数 的数字 并且假设这个数字一定存在 ,显然这个数字只可能有一个。 摩尔投票算法是基于这个事实:每次从序列里选择两个不相同的数字删除掉 或称为 抵消 ,最后剩下一个数字或几个相同的数字,就是出现次数大于总数一半的那个。 二:代码 三:算法详解 作者:喝七喜 链接:https: www.zhihu.com question an ...

2019-03-04 11:22 0 544 推荐指数:

查看详情

Moore majority vote algorithm(摩尔投票算法)

Boyer-Moore majority vote algorithm(摩尔投票算法) 简介 Boyer-Moore majority vote algorithm(摩尔投票算法)是一种在线性时间O(n)和空间复杂度的情况下,在一个元素序列中查找包含最多的元素。它是以Robert ...

Sun Mar 12 07:32:00 CST 2017 1 6853
投票算法

的。 经理看到这一群不省油的灯,突然想到一个办法,说道:“别吵了!咱们都是写程序的,用一个算法来解决这个问题 ...

Sun Apr 21 21:43:00 CST 2019 0 748
摩尔投票

目录 229. 求众数 II 思路 方法一:哈希统计 方法二:摩尔投票法 代码 229. 求众数 II 思路 方法一:哈希统计 用哈希统计数组中每个元素出现的次数 ...

Fri Oct 22 20:54:00 CST 2021 0 2175
投票排名算法

转载自:http://www.ruanyifeng.com/blog/2012/03/ranking_algorithm_bayesian_average.html 基于用户投票的排名算法(一):Delicious和Hacker News   互联网的出现,意味着"信息大爆炸 ...

Thu Apr 19 02:37:00 CST 2012 0 8809
基于投票的热门计数算法策略

类似基于投票的热门计数算法普遍应用在热门文章,热门评论等场景中, 典型的比如网易和今日头条的评论区,国外比如Hacker News和Reddit的主题排序。 一.Hacker News的排序算法 Hacker News是一个主题社区,用户可以为主题投票 ...

Tue Nov 15 04:39:00 CST 2016 2 1122
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M